    What is the definition of Postural Orthostatic Tachycardia Syndrome (POTS)?

    Postural orthostatic tachycardia syndrome (POTS) is a condition characterized by too little blood returning to the heart when moving from a lying down to a standing up position (orthostatic intolerance). POTS causes lightheadedness or fainting that can be eased by lying back down. Although POTS can affect men and women of all ages, most cases are diagnosed in women between the ages of 15 and 50. In women, episodes may also begin after pregnancy and the symptoms may worsen or the number of episodes may increase right before menstruation. The goal of treatment is to increase blood flow, lower heart rate, sometimes increase blood pressure, and improve circulatory problems that may be causing POTS.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Postural Orthostatic Tachycardia Syndrome (POTS) doctor in Arkansas, US?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it. 

    What questions should I ask my Postural Orthostatic Tachycardia Syndrome (POTS) doctor?

    Here are some sample questions: 

    • Can you explain in simple terms what this condition is and how it’s treated? 
    • What symptoms or side effects should I watch for? 
    • What tests will be involved, and when can I expect results? 
    • Are there other specialists I need to see? 
    • What’s the best way to reach you if I have follow-up questions?
